This practical Certificate programme provides authoritative guidance on developing best practice in this rapidly changing field. An ageing population, the increase of globalisation and continuing economic uncertainty mean that organisations have to think differently about the way they attract and retain the talent they have in order to maintain competitive advantage. So now more than ever it is crucial to develop recruitment and retention strategies that have a demonstrable impact on organisational success. The CIPD Certificate in Recruitment and Selection takes a skill-based approach and provides practical and authoritative guidance on how to formulate and implement best practice within the context of today's challenging workplace.

Programme Content:
- Professional and ethical standards and codes of practice
- Identifying and developing recruitment strategies
- Preparing and conducting interviews
- Relevant legislation and how it is applied
- Evaluating and utilising the range of selection tools available, including:
-Psychometric tests
-Biodata
-Assessment centres
-Video-based interviewing
-Health questionnaires

The programme takes place over a period of 6 months. Participants must attend 10 training/contact days (delivered in 7 modules), where you will engage in workshops with tutor input, group exercises and learning reviews. Beyond this you must:
-
Complete two assessed written assignments
-
Complete two assessed skills-based assignments (takes place within the contact sessions)
-
Complete an assessed work-related project
-
Maintain a personal development portfolio that illustrates your learning
How long will it take me?
The seven modules, along with associated assessments etc., are typically scheduled across a period of 6 months. If however you wish to deliver the CRS internally in your organisation, we can tailor the timelines to meet your needs.
Note: You have a maximum of two years to complete the requirements of the programme
Does the certificate lead to CIPD membership?
Yes. Whilst studying you are an Affiliate (Studying) member of the CIPD. Successful completion of the Certificate leads to Associate membership of the CIPD.
Note: The registration fee for CIPD membership is not included in the Certificate fee.
